Runbook: Scanline barcode bridge

If warehouse scans stop flowing into Cartwheel, it's almost always the bridge service on the Dunmore floor box wedging after a USB hiccup. Bounce the service first — nine times out of ten that fixes it. If not, check the queue depth before escalating. When restarting, make sure the bridge comes up with these settings.

deployment values, yafop-bajef:
[gilok]
team = ulaius
access_code = ac_423664
host = gilok.sivrelhq.corp
port = 9200
owner = pelius.istax
peer = eliok.torvasoft.internal

# Weather-alert fan-out service (Gustline)
# Review notes: this env file drives the fan-out worker that pushes
# severe-weather alerts from the Halloway ingest queue to regional
# subscriber shards. FANOUT_CONCURRENCY stays at 8 until the Brinmore
# shard migration lands — higher values starve the ingest loop.
# ALERT_TTL_SECONDS must exceed the retry backoff ceiling or dupes
# appear downstream. Regions are comma-separated, no spaces.
# The push gateway requires an auth secret; it is set on the next line.

sealed setting: RELAY_SECRET5=82864

PortionForge scales recipe quantities for the Meadowhatch kitchen suite. Review scope: the conversion service, unit-parsing library, and the vault that stores signing material for scaled-recipe exports. Access is read-only by default; escalation goes through the Brinewell approval queue. Audit logs retain 90 days. Test data only — no production recipes in staging. Vault access during review uses the shared recovery credential rotated each quarter by the platform team. To unlock the review vault, enter the passphrase below exactly as written.

unlock words, tagaf-hahif: ralwyn-lammir-rusax-sormir

Handover — Vexler partner SFTP drop

Ownership moves to you today. Drop runs hourly from Vexler's end into the intake bucket via the relay host. Watch for zero-byte files; their exporter flakes on Mondays. Creds live in the ops vault, path noted in the runbook. Vault auto-seals after 48h idle. Support escalations go to the on-call rotation, not me. If the vault is sealed when you need it, unseal with the recovery passphrase below.

recovery phrase for tadug-fafof: zorwyn-kasion